Output 311184ddfb36b1f10cab1fc889c421781775fb45a33e265dc7fb60e0b1dbc42d:12

value
1616618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fad13b6f42e37dbf2a213337ff4c0e6fb9231c OP_EQUAL
address
3Dp9axWJn14dVeAx1Jdu7W6wcAxjjSiaDk
transaction
311184ddfb36b1f10cab1fc889c421781775fb45a33e265dc7fb60e0b1dbc42d
spent
true